What I do to get around transparency and misalignment is get out my header, stick the buttons on it and line 'em up, crop from the base of the header to a couple pixels above the buttons, hide the buttons for a bit and make what's left of the header into the menu background, then show the buttons again and crop them individually.
It doesn't always work out right the first time -- it takes some tweaking and adding a certain number of pixels to either side of the button sometimes, but in the end, it's more efficient if done correctly. [:
